Sec. 19a-285a. Donation of blood by minors.

      Sec. 19a-285a. Donation of blood by minors. Any person who is seventeen years of age or older shall have the legal capacity, without written authorization of his or her parent or guardian, to donate blood or any component thereof and to consent to the withdrawal of blood from his or her body, in conjunction with any voluntary blood donation program.

      (P.A. 83-294.)
